标题:提升安全性:轻比特币钱包对接网站的最佳实践
一、引言
随着区块链技术的不断发展,比特币作为一种去中心化的数字货币,逐渐受到广大用户的关注。轻比特币钱包因其便捷性、安全性等优点,成为比特币用户的首选。然而,轻比特币钱包对接网站的安全性也成为用户关注的焦点。本文将针对提升轻比特币钱包对接网站的安全性,提出最佳实践。
二、提升安全性轻比特币钱包对接网站的最佳实践
1. 加密通信
(1)使用HTTPS协议:确保网站与用户之间的数据传输过程加密,防止数据被窃取。
(2)采用强加密算法:如AES、RSA等,提高数据加密强度。
2. 防止中间人攻击
(1)使用证书颁发机构(CA)签发的SSL证书,确保网站身份的真实性。
(2)定期更新证书,避免证书过期导致的安全隐患。
3. 防止CSRF攻击
(1)在网站中实现CSRF防护机制,如验证Referer字段、添加CSRF令牌等。
(2)对于敏感操作,要求用户二次确认,降低CSRF攻击风险。
4. 防止XSS攻击
(1)对用户输入进行严格的过滤和转义,避免XSS攻击。
(2)使用内容安全策略(CSP)限制网页资源加载,降低XSS攻击风险。
5. 加强身份验证
(1)采用多因素认证,如密码、手机短信验证码、邮箱验证码等。
(2)限制登录尝试次数,避免暴力破解。
6. 数据备份与恢复
(1)定期对重要数据进行备份,确保数据安全。
(2)制定数据恢复方案,提高应对突发情况的能力。
7. 安全审计
(1)定期对网站进行安全审计,发现并修复安全漏洞。
(2)关注行业安全动态,及时更新安全防护措施。
三、常见问答知识清单及解答
1. 什么是轻比特币钱包?
答:轻比特币钱包是一种无需下载完整区块链数据的比特币钱包,用户可以通过同步部分区块数据来管理比特币。
2. 轻比特币钱包对接网站有哪些优势?
答:轻比特币钱包对接网站具有以下优势:
(1)便捷性:用户无需下载完整区块链数据,即可使用比特币。
(2)安全性:轻比特币钱包对接网站采用多种安全措施,保障用户资产安全。
3. 如何防止轻比特币钱包对接网站被攻击?
答:防止轻比特币钱包对接网站被攻击的措施包括:
(1)加密通信,使用HTTPS协议、强加密算法等。
(2)防止中间人攻击,使用SSL证书、定期更新证书等。
(3)防止CSRF攻击,实现CSRF防护机制、二次确认等。
(4)防止XSS攻击,对用户输入进行过滤和转义、使用CSP等。
4. 轻比特币钱包对接网站如何实现多因素认证?
答:轻比特币钱包对接网站实现多因素认证的方法包括:
(1)密码验证。
(2)手机短信验证码。
(3)邮箱验证码。
5. 轻比特币钱包对接网站如何进行数据备份?
答:轻比特币钱包对接网站进行数据备份的方法包括:
(1)定期备份重要数据。
(2)将备份数据存储在安全的地方。
6. 轻比特币钱包对接网站如何进行安全审计?
答:轻比特币钱包对接网站进行安全审计的方法包括:
(1)定期对网站进行安全检查。
(2)关注行业安全动态,及时更新安全防护措施。
7. 轻比特币钱包对接网站如何应对突发情况?
答:轻比特币钱包对接网站应对突发情况的方法包括:
(1)制定数据恢复方案。
(2)建立应急响应机制。
8. 如何选择安全可靠的轻比特币钱包对接网站?
答:选择安全可靠的轻比特币钱包对接网站可以从以下几个方面考虑:
(1)查看网站的信誉度、用户评价。
(2)了解网站的安全防护措施。
(3)关注行业动态,了解网站的最新安全措施。
9. 轻比特币钱包对接网站如何处理用户隐私?
答:轻比特币钱包对接网站处理用户隐私的方法包括:
(1)不收集用户隐私信息。
(2)对收集到的用户信息进行加密存储。
(3)遵守相关法律法规,保护用户隐私。
10. 轻比特币钱包对接网站如何应对恶意软件攻击?
答:轻比特币钱包对接网站应对恶意软件攻击的方法包括:
(1)定期更新软件,修复安全漏洞。
(2)加强对恶意软件的检测和拦截。
(3)提高用户安全意识,避免下载恶意软件。